Pixar's latest film, Hoppers, directed by Daniel Chong and written by Jesse Andrews, offers a refreshing departure from the studio's recent sequels and high-concept disappointments. The movie follows Mabel Tanaka, a college misfit and environmental activist, as she embarks on a mission to save her beloved forest glade from destruction by the town's mayor, Jerry. With the help of a high-tech experiment called Hoppers, Mabel enters the body of a robot beaver to communicate with the forest creatures and uncover the mystery of their disappearance.

As Mabel delves deeper into the forest, she encounters a diverse community of animals, including the friendly beaver king, George, and a royal goose voiced by the late Isiah Whitlock Jr. and an imperious monarch butterfly voiced by Meryl Streep. The film's premise, which involves mind-bending body-swapping and environmental themes, leads to a series of humorous and surreal adventures that pay homage to classic horror films like The Birds and Jaws.

Hoppers' blend of comedy, strangeness, and environmental advocacy sets it apart from Pixar's recent offerings, offering a fresh and entertaining take on the relationship between humans and animals. The film's message about coexistence is beautifully illustrated through the unlikely friendship between Mabel and George, showcasing Pixar's return to form in delivering a heartwarming and thought-provoking story.
